Understanding the basics of staining is essential before diving into techniques that will elevate your projects. Wood staining, in essence, penetrates the surface, enhancing the natural wood grain and providing rich color. This approach not only adds aesthetic value but also offers protection against elements such as moisture and UV rays. By layering stains, a process at the heart of advanced methods, you can create stunning visual depth that paints alone cannot achieve.

One of the most effective ways to add dimension is by utilizing the layering technique. Inspired By U’s experts frequently recommend starting with a base stain that sets the tone for your project. For instance, a lighter base can create a warm, inviting atmosphere, while a dark base can add drama and sophistication. Once the base layer is applied and dried properly, a secondary, contrasting stain can be applied to highlight certain features like natural wood patterns. This overlay method uncovers the wood's inherent beauty, giving each project a unique finish.

Incorporating glazing techniques further enhances the depth effect. Glaze is a thin, translucent coating applied over stains and is particularly useful for adding intricate details. This method is ideal for accentuating the contours and adding aged effects to furniture or cabinetry. When opting for outdoor renovations, such as decking, the staining process must consider additional factors like weather resistance. Choosing high-grade stains that prevent rot and decay is essential. Transparent or semi-transparent stains can be used as the first layer to seal and protect the wood while allowing natural knots and grains to show through. Following this, a more opaque stain can be applied to create visual interest or complement the external environment by mimicking natural stone, for example.

Throughout these staining processes, the importance of surface preparation cannot be overstated. Proper sanding and cleaning before applying any stain ensure optimal adherence and a smoother finish. It’s crucial to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for drying times and application recommendations to avoid pitfalls such as overlapping marks or uneven color spreads.
